A recent BBC report highlights a significant uptick in cross-border acquisitions by Indian corporations and wealthy individuals. India Inc. invested approximately $18 billion in global buyouts during 2025, and deal values could surpass $15 billion in the first half of 2026 alone. This acceleration comes as India’s domestic growth momentum shows signs of cooling, pushing major business groups to look abroad for new revenue streams and asset acquisitions. The report notes that Indian billionaires are leading this wave, targeting companies in sectors such as technology, healthcare, and consumer goods. Notable transactions in 2025 included acquisitions of mid-sized European and US firms, though the BBC did not name specific deals. The pace of outbound M&A suggests a structural shift in Indian corporate strategy, moving from primarily domestic-focused expansion to a more globalized approach. Factors supporting this trend include favorable currency conditions, ample liquidity from domestic markets, and attractive valuations of overseas targets amid global economic uncertainty. The first half of 2026 is expected to maintain the momentum, with deal pipelines reportedly strong across multiple industries. Outbound acquisitions may help Indian companies access new technologies, markets, and talent, potentially enhancing their global competitiveness. The sectors most targeted could include advanced manufacturing, digital services, and green energy, aligning with India’s long-term economic priorities. From a market perspective, this trend suggests that Indian corporates are increasingly confident in their ability to integrate foreign assets, despite integration risks. The BBC report indicates that the deal value for 2026’s first half—estimated at over $15 billion—would represent a significant acceleration if realized, nearly matching the full-year 2025 figure in just six months. Domestically, the shift could imply that India’s business leaders are hedging against slower growth at home by diversifying earnings geographically. However, the capital outflow may also impact the rupee and domestic investment levels, though the BBC did not quantify these effects. The trend mirrors similar patterns seen in other emerging economies during periods of domestic slowdown. Companies pursuing foreign acquisitions could benefit from enhanced scale and product offerings, but they also face execution risks, regulatory hurdles, and potential currency volatility. The cautious language used in the BBC report—such as “could cross” $15 billion—underscores the conditional nature of these projections. Broader economic implications include India’s deepening integration into global supply chains and capital markets. If the trend continues, it might lead to increased cross-border synergies and technology transfers, potentially boosting India’s export competitiveness over the medium term. However, the domestic growth slowdown that drives this trend could itself be a concern for near-term earnings prospects. Investors should monitor how these acquisitions perform post-close, as integration success varies widely. Similar patterns have been observed in China and Brazil during their growth deceleration phases, with mixed outcomes. The acceleration in Indian outbound M&A signals a new phase in the country’s corporate evolution, but the ultimate impact will depend on global market conditions and domestic policy stability.
